zpp
Zephyr C++20 Framework
zpp::sem_ref Member List

This is the complete list of members for zpp::sem_ref, including all inherited members.

count() noexceptzpp::sem_base< sem_ref >inline
counter_type typedefzpp::sem_base< sem_ref >
give() noexceptzpp::sem_base< sem_ref >inline
max_countzpp::sem_base< sem_ref >static
native_const_pointer typedefzpp::sem_base< sem_ref >
native_handle() noexcept -> native_pointerzpp::sem_refinline
native_handle() const noexcept -> native_const_pointerzpp::sem_refinline
native_pointer typedefzpp::sem_base< sem_ref >
native_type typedefzpp::sem_base< sem_ref >
operator++(int) noexceptzpp::sem_base< sem_ref >inline
operator+=(int n) noexceptzpp::sem_base< sem_ref >inline
operator--(int) noexceptzpp::sem_base< sem_ref >inline
operator-=(int n) noexceptzpp::sem_base< sem_ref >inline
operator=(native_pointer s) noexceptzpp::sem_refinline
operator=(T_Sem &s) noexceptzpp::sem_refinline
sem_base< sem_ref >::operator=(const sem_base &)=deletezpp::sem_base< sem_ref >
sem_base< sem_ref >::operator=(sem_base &&)=deletezpp::sem_base< sem_ref >
reset() noexceptzpp::sem_base< sem_ref >inline
sem_base() noexceptzpp::sem_base< sem_ref >inlineprotected
sem_base(const sem_base &)=deletezpp::sem_base< sem_ref >
sem_base(sem_base &&)=deletezpp::sem_base< sem_ref >
sem_ref(native_pointer s) noexceptzpp::sem_refinlineexplicit
sem_ref(T_Sem &s) noexceptzpp::sem_refinlineexplicit
sem_ref()=deletezpp::sem_ref
take() noexceptzpp::sem_base< sem_ref >inline
try_take() noexceptzpp::sem_base< sem_ref >inline
try_take_for(const std::chrono::duration< T_Rep, T_Period > &timeout_duration) noexceptzpp::sem_base< sem_ref >inline